Luxor was built on the Nile River to host three of the most famous historic sites of Egypt: the Valley of the Kings, the Karnak Temple, and the Luxor Temple. 2. The Valley of Kings:

Valley of the Kings - Egypt Fun Tours

This forms one of the UNESCO World Heritage sites and one of the major attractions to any tour within Luxor, housing most of the tombs of many pharaohs, which include the famous tomb of Tutankhamun. So, such a place allows one to view how ancient Egypt did burials and the works of art involved in the process.

3. The Beautiful Tomb of Queen Nefertari:

Valley of the Queens QV66

Many consider this tomb the most beautiful in Egypt, featuring marvelous wall paintings and intricate designs. Indeed, visiting this tomb gives an insight into the life and history of one of Egypt’s most revered queens.
